Page 2638 of 4770

DI4DP±01
A02508
E11E10
E9E8
313029
2827 17
18 19 20 21
2223 24
25 26 11 1 2 13 14 15
161 2
3 4
5 6 7
8 9
101 2 3 4
5 6 7
8 9 10 11 12 13
14 15
16 17 18
19 20 21 22 23 241 2
3 4 5 6 7
89
10
11 12 13 14 15 16 1
2 3 4 5 6
78
9 10 11 12
13 14 15 16
1718
19
20 21 22
ECM Terminals
E7
141
2 3
4 5 6 8
7 9
10 12 13 15 16
17 18 19 20 21
22 11
23 24
25 26 27
2817
DI±218
± DIAGNOSTICSENGINE (1MZ±FE)
453 Author: Date:
TERMINALS OF ECM
Symbols (Terminals No.)Wiring ColorConditionSTD Voltage (V)
BATT (E7 ± 1) ± E1 (E10 ± 17)B±Y eBRAlways9 ~ 14
+B (E7 ± 16) ± E1 (E10 ± 17)R e BRIG switch ON9 ~ 14
VC (E10 ± 2) ± E2 (E10 ± 18)Y e BRIG switch ON4.5 ~ 5.5
VTA1 (E10 ± 23) LBR
IG switch ON
Throttle valve fully closed0.3 ~ 1.0VTA1 (E10 23)
± E2 (E10 ± 18)Le BRIG switch ON
Throttle valve fully open3.2 ~ 4.9
VG (E10 ± 10)
± E2G (E10 ± 19)P eR±BIdling , A/C switch OFF1.1 ~ 1.5
THA (E10 ± 22) ± E2 (E10 ± 18)L±Y eBRIdling, Intake air temp. 20°C (68°F)0.5 ~ 3.4
THW (E10 ±14) ± E2 (E10 ± 18)G±B eBRIdling, Engine coolant temp. 80°C (176°F) 0.2 ~ 1.0
STA (E7 ± 7) ± E1 (E10 ± 17)GR e BRCranking6.0 or more
#10 (E10 5)IG switch ON9 ~ 14#10 (E10 ± 5)
± E01 (E11 ± 21)L eBRIdlingPulse generation
(See page DI±276)
#20 (E10 6)IG switch ON9 ~ 14#20 (E10 ± 6)
± E01 (E11 ± 21)R eBRIdlingPulse generation
(See page DI±276)
#30 (E11 1)IG switch ON9 ~ 14#30 (E11 ± 1)
± E01 (E11 ± 21)Y eBRIdlingPulse generation
(See page DI±276)
#40 (E11 2)IG switch ON9 ~ 14#40 (E11 ± 2)
± E01 (E11 ± 21)W eBRIdlingPulse generation
(See page DI±276)
#50 (E11 3)IG switch ON9 ~ 14#50 (E11 ± 3)
± E01 (E11 ± 21)R±L eBRIdlingPulse generation
(See page DI±276)
#60 (E11 4)IG switch ON9 ~ 14#60 (E11 ± 4)
± E01 (E11 ± 21)G eBRIdlingPulse generation
(See page DI±276)
IGT1 (E11 ± 11)
± E1 (E10± 17)GR eBRIdlingPulse generation
(See page DI±351)
IGT2 (E11 ± 12)
± E1 (E10 ± 17)BR±Y eBRIdlingPulse generation
(See page DI±351)
IGT3 (E11 ± 13)
± E1 (E10 ± 17)LG±B eBRIdlingPulse generation
(See page DI±351)
Page 2649 of 4770
FI6448
Intake Air Temp. Sensor
(Inside the Mass Air Flow Meter)ECM
5 V
THA
E2
E1 1
2R
L±Y
BR
E10E1022
18
± DIAGNOSTICSENGINE (1MZ±FE)
DI±229
464 Author: Date:
WIRING DIAGRAM
INSPECTION PROCEDURE
HINT:
If DTCs P0110 (Intake Air Temp. Circuit Malfunction), P0115 (Engine Coolant Temp. Circuit Malfunc-
tion), P0120 (Throttle/Pedal Position Sensor/Switch ºAº Circuit Malfunction) and P1410 (EGR Valve
Position Sensor Circuit Malfunction) are output simultaneously, E2 (Sensor Ground) may be open.
Read freeze frame data using TOYOTA hand±held tester or OBD II scan tool. Because freeze frame
records the engine conditions when the malfunction is detected, when troubleshooting it is useful for
determining whether the vehicle was running or stopped, the engine warmed up or not, the air±fuel
ratio lean or rich, etc. at the time of the malfunction.
Page 2653 of 4770

FI6448
Engine Coolant Temp. SensorECM
5V
THW
E2
E1 2
1G±B
BR
E10
14
18
E10
± DIAGNOSTICSENGINE (1MZ±FE)
DI±233
468 Author: Date:
DTC P0115 Engine Coolant Temp. Circuit Malfunction
CIRCUIT DESCRIPTION
A thermistor built into the engine coolant temp. sensor changes the resistance value according to the engine
coolant temp.
The structure of the sensor and connection to the ECM is the same as in the intake air temp. circuit malfunc-
tion shown on page DI±228.
If the ECM detects the DTC P0115, it operates fail±safe function in which the engine coolant temperature
is assumed to be 80°C (176°F).
DTC No.Detection ItemTrouble Area
P0115Open or short in engine coolant temp. sensor circuit
Open or short in engine coolant temp. sensor circuit
Engine coolant temp. sensor
ECM
HINT:
After confirming DTC P0115, use the OBD II scan tool or TOYOTA hand±held tester to confirm the engine
coolant temp. from CURRENT DATA.
Temperature DisplayedMalfunction
±40°C (±40°F)Open circuit
140°C (284°F) or moreShort circuit
WIRING DIAGRAM
INSPECTION PROCEDURE
HINT:
If DTCs P0110 (Intake Air Temp. Circuit Malfunction), P0115 (Engine Coolant Temp. Circuit Malfunc-
tion), P0120 (Throttle/Pedal/Position Sensor/Switch ºAº Circuit Malfunction) and P1410 (EGR Valve
Position Sensor Circuit Malfunction) are output simultaneously, E2 (Sensor Ground) may be open.
Read freeze frame data using TOYOTA hand±held tester or OBD II scan tool. Because freeze frame
records the engine conditions when the malfunction is detected, when troubleshooting it is useful for
determining whether the vehicle was running or stopped, the engine warmed up or not, the air±fuel
ratio lean or rich, etc. at the time of the malfunction.
DI07I±06
Page 2654 of 4770

A00214
ON
Engine Coolant
Temp. Sensor
ECM
5 V
E2
2
1
THWE10
E101814
DI±234
± DIAGNOSTICSENGINE (1MZ±FE)
469 Author: Date:
1 Connect OBD II scan tool or TOYOTA hand±held tester, and read value of engine
coolant temperature.
PREPARATION:
(a) Connect the OBD II scan tool or TOYOTA hand±held tester to the DLC3.
(b) Turn the ignition switch ON and push the OBD II scan tool or TOYOTA hand±held tester main switch
ON.
CHECK:
Read temperature value on the OBD II scan tool or TOYOTA hand±held tester.
OK:
Same as actual engine coolant temperature.
HINT:
If there is open circuit, OBD II scan tool or TOYOTA hand±held tester indicates ±40°C (±40°F).
If there is open circuit, OBD II scan tool or TOYOTA hand-held tester indicates 140°C (284°F) or more.
NG ±40°C (±40°F) ... Go to step 2.
140°C (284°F) or more ... Go to step 4.
OK
Check for intermittent problems
(See page DI±197).
2 Check for open in harness or ECM.
PREPARATION:
(a) Disconnect the engine coolant temp. sensor connector.
(b) Connect the sensor wire harness terminals together.
(c) Turn the ignition switch ON.
CHECK:
Read temp. value on the OBD II scan tool or TOYOTA
hand±held tester.
OK:
Temperature value: 1405C (2845F) or more
OK Confirm good connection at sensor.
If OK, replace engine coolant temp. sensor.
NG
Page 2655 of 4770

A02020
ON
Engine Coolant Temp. Sensor
ECM
THW E2
E10
E1014
185 V
THW
E2
1 2
A00216
ON
Engine Coolant
Temp. Sensor
ECM
5 V
E2 THWE1018 14
E10
± DIAGNOSTICSENGINE (1MZ±FE)
DI±235
470 Author: Date:
3 Check for open in harness or ECM.
PREPARATION:
(a) Remove the glove compartment (See page SF±73).
(b) Connect between terminals THW and E2 of the ECM con-
nector.
HINT:
Engine coolant temp. sensor connector is disconnected. Be-
fore checking, do a visual and contact pressure check for the
ECM connector (See page IN±31).
(c) Turn the ignition switch ON.
CHECK:
Read temperature. value on the OBD II scan tool or TOYOTA
hand±held tester.
OK:
Temperature value: 1405C (2845F) or more
OK Open in harness between terminal E2 or THW,
repair or replace harness.
NG
Confirm good connection at ECM.
If OK, check and replace ECM.
4 Check for short in harness and ECM.
PREPARATION:
(a) Disconnect the engine coolant temp. sensor connector.
(b) Turn the ignition switch ON.
CHECK:
Read temperature value on the OBD II scan tool or TOYOTA
hand±held tester.
OK:
Temperature value: ±405C (±405F)
OK Replace engine coolant temp. sensor.
NG
Page 2656 of 4770
A02043
ON
ECM
Engine Coolant Temp. Sensor
THW
E2
E105 V
DI±236
± DIAGNOSTICSENGINE (1MZ±FE)
471 Author: Date:
5 Check for short in harness or ECM.
PREPARATION:
(a) Remove the glove compartment (See page SF±73).
(b) Disconnect the E10 connector of the ECM.
HINT:
Engine coolant temp. sensor connector is disconnected.
(c) Turn the ignition switch ON.
CHECK:
Read temperature value on the OBD II scan tool or TOYOTA
hand±held tester.
OK:
Temperature value: ±405C (±405F)
OK Repair or replace harness or connector.
NG
Check and replace ECM (See page IN±31).
Page 2657 of 4770

± DIAGNOSTICSENGINE (1MZ±FE)
DI±237
472 Author: Date:
DTC P0116 Engine Coolant Temp. Circuit Range/
Performance Problem
CIRCUIT DESCRIPTION
Refer to DTC P0115 (Engine Coolant Temp. Circuit Malfunction) on page DI±233.
DTC No.DTC Detecting ConditionTrouble Area
If THW ±7°C (19.4°F), 20 min. or more after starting
engine, engine coolant temp. sensor value is 20°C (68°F) or
less
(2 trip detection logic)
If THW ±7°C (19.4°F) and 10°C (50°F), 5 min. or more
after starting engine,
engine coolant temp. sensor value is 20°C (68°F) or less
(2 trip detection logic)
Engine coolant temp sensorP0116If THW 10°C (50 °F), 2 min. or more after starting engine,
engine coolant temp. sensor value is 30°C (86°F)
(2 trip detection logic)Engine coolant temp. sensor
Cooling system
When THW 35°C (95°F) or more and less than 60°C
(140°F), THA ± 6.7°C (19.9°F) or more, when starting
engine , condition (a) and (b) continues:
(a) Vehicle speed is changing (Not stable)
(b) When starting engine, THW< 3°C (37.4°F)
(2 trip detection logic)
INSPECTION PROCEDURE
HINT:
If DTCs P0115 (Engine Coolant Temp. Circuit Malfunction) and P0116 (Engine Coolant Temp. Circuit
Range/Performance) are output simultaneously, engine coolant temp. sensor circuit may be open.
Perform troubleshooting of DTC P0115 first.
Read freeze frame data using TOYOTA hand±held tester or OBD II scan tool. Because freeze frame
records the engine conditions when the malfunction is detected, when troubleshooting it is useful for
determining whether the vehicle was running or stopped, the engine warmed up or not, the air±fuel
ratio lean or rich, etc. at the time of the malfunction.
1 Are there any other codes (besides DTC P0116) being output?
YES Go to relevant DTC chart.
NO
DI07J±06
Page 2658 of 4770
DI±238
± DIAGNOSTICSENGINE (1MZ±FE)
473 Author: Date:
2 Check thermostat (See page CO±9).
NG Replace thermostat.
OK
Replace engine coolant temp. sensor.